Understanding the Mana Curve
|
||||||
|
<br>The average elixir cost of your deck dictates exactly how fast you can play cards and cycle back to your win condition.<br>
|
||||||
|
<br>If your deck is too heavy, you will sit defenseless while the opponent chips away at your towers with cheap, fast attacks.<br>
|
||||||
|
Card SlotGood ChoiceWhy It's NeededWin ConditionBalloon, Royal Giant, X-BowThe only reliable way to deal massive damage to the enemy structuresSmall SpellZap, The Log, SnowballInstantly clears cheap swarm units that threaten your main attacker
